Output f62240d1ea79e2c08c295407b611583074041fe7b0b84f676a821f8cb751bb97:1

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c436a51a47ea789f800fc5a0a3a08f588e4810 OP_EQUAL
address
3KdRRHvDQX8hP1oKsqAzLXS6ZD8XYTLzz5
transaction
f62240d1ea79e2c08c295407b611583074041fe7b0b84f676a821f8cb751bb97
spent
true